Jump Space releases on September 19, 2025 at 7AM PT / 10AM ET / 3PM BST / 4PM CEST on PC (Steam) and Xbox Series X | S. This highly anticipated co-op space adventure brings together up to four players as the crew of a spaceship, seamlessly transitioning between piloting, on-foot exploration, and intense space combat. With over one million Steam wishlists and 500,000+ players from the Steam Next Fest demo, Jump Space is shaping up to be 2025's must-play cooperative experience.

The development team at Keepsake Games has revealed an extensive roadmap that showcases their commitment to long-term support and continuous content updates throughout 2025 and beyond.
At launch, Jump Space will have: 9 Mission Types, 50+ Playable sectors, 4 Unlockable galaxy regions, 2 Ships to pilot, 26 Ship components, 8 Player weapons, 16 Ship enemies, 11 Ground enemies
The launch build represents months of refinement based on community feedback from the Steam Next Fest demo. Players start with the Catamaran ship and work to restore it to full operational capacity. As you progress through missions, you'll discover wreckage that unlocks a second ship type, adding variety to your fleet management strategies.

Text Chat and Lobby browser will be available at Jump Space launch, but there are several planned updates for Q1 2026 which you can see below: Endless mode, New Gun and Melee weapons, Hangar Vendors, Offline Support, More Sectors as well as added Sector Modifiers, New Ship as well as more Components and Artifacts, New Story, Mission types and Enemies, Ship Shield revamp and Buddybot improvements, Slide Movement, Photo Mode
The second chapter introduces game-changing features that will significantly expand gameplay variety:
Endless Mode represents a major addition for players seeking infinite replayability. This roguelike-inspired mode will challenge crews with increasingly difficult waves of enemies and environmental hazards, perfect for testing your team's coordination limits.
Offline Support addresses one of the community's most requested features, allowing solo players to enjoy the full Jump Space experience without requiring an internet connection. This update ensures the game remains playable even when servers are down or when you're traveling.
The Ship Shield Revamp promises to overhaul one of the core defensive mechanics, making shield management more strategic and rewarding skilled play. Combined with Buddybot Improvements, solo players will have better AI companion support for tackling challenging missions alone.
As for the rest of 2026, Jump Space is planning to add: More Sectors, Missions types and a Story expansion, New Ship, Gun, and Weapon types, New Enemies as well as a Ground Boss, 1st Person Pilot view, Voice Chat, Scanner Revamp
Chapter 3 represents the game's evolution into a more comprehensive space adventure. The 1st Person Pilot View will dramatically change the piloting experience, offering increased immersion for those who prefer cockpit perspectives over third-person navigation.
Voice Chat integration will streamline team communication, eliminating the need for third-party applications like Discord during intense missions. This native solution will include proximity chat for added immersion and strategic depth.
The Scanner Revamp acknowledges current limitations in the scanning mechanic, transforming it from a simple detection tool into an engaging gameplay system with mini-games, hidden cache discoveries, and enemy ship hacking capabilities.

Jump Space distinguishes itself in the crowded co-op shooter market through its seamless integration of multiple gameplay styles within a single mission structure.
Seamlessly go on and off ship - Once you've jumped with your ship, you can switch seamlessly between operating your ship, space walking and on-foot planetary exploration, it just works. This technical achievement eliminates loading screens between different gameplay modes, maintaining immersion as you transition from piloting through an asteroid field to jetpacking toward an enemy vessel for sabotage operations.
The game's physics system allows for creative problem-solving. Players can exit their ship mid-flight, jetpack to an enemy vessel, disable its weapons from inside, then return to their ship—all while their teammates continue fighting. This freedom creates emergent gameplay moments that feel genuinely cinematic.
Unlike traditional class-based shooters, There are no set classes in Jump Space, improvise and decide how you want to engage. This flexibility means any player can switch from pilot to engineer to combat specialist based on immediate needs.
During my research, I discovered that this system encourages organic teamwork. When your ship catches fire during combat, whoever's closest becomes the firefighter. When shields fail, the nearest player rushes to the power grid to reroute energy. This dynamic approach keeps gameplay fresh and prevents role fatigue common in rigid class systems.
One particularly innovative feature is the physical power management system. "Engines, weapons, and other systems are powered by arranging physical blocks on a grid on one of the walls." This tangible approach to ship management transforms abstract concepts into engaging puzzles that directly impact combat effectiveness.
When your ship takes damage, sections of the power grid can become disabled, forcing players to physically rearrange power blocks mid-combat. This creates intense moments where one player desperately reorganizes the power grid while others defend against boarding enemies or repair hull breaches.
Upgrade and customise your ship as you face off against the challenges of space exploration, and scavenge resources to ensure your survival. Reinforce your defences, adjust your energy output for speed or bolster your ship's attack capabilities - the choice is yours.
The upgrade system extends beyond simple stat increases. Each component affects ship handling, combat effectiveness, and even mission approach strategies. Want to focus on speed for hit-and-run tactics? Prioritize engine upgrades. Prefer tanking damage while your crew boards enemy ships? Invest in shields and armor plating.

Jump Space is a co-op exploration game with up to four players. That means you and three more friends. The game's design philosophy prioritizes cooperation without forcing it, creating opportunities for teamwork while remaining accessible to different playstyles.
Lobby Browser System: Available at launch, the lobby browser lets you join public games or create private sessions for your crew. Advanced filtering options help you find games matching your preferred difficulty, mission type, and player count.
Text Chat Integration: Also available from day one, text chat ensures communication even without voice capabilities. Quick commands and contextual callouts supplement typed messages for efficient coordination during intense moments.
Difficulty Scaling: The game dynamically adjusts challenge levels based on player count, ensuring solo players aren't overwhelmed while four-player crews still face meaningful challenges. Enemy health, spawn rates, and objective complexity all scale appropriately.
While designed for cooperation, Jump Space is best enjoyed with friends, but solo adventurers are welcome too. The development team has invested significant resources into making solo play viable and enjoyable.
The Buddybot companion system provides AI assistance for solo players, handling basic tasks like manning turrets or repairing systems. While not as effective as human teammates, Buddybot ensures solo players can experience all content without frustration.
Future updates promise enhanced solo features, including improved AI companions and mission balancing specifically tuned for single-player experiences. The upcoming offline mode in Chapter 2 will further cement Jump Space as a viable solo adventure.

The game will launch globally on September 19th, 2025 at 7 AM PT | 10 AM ET | 3 PM BST | 4 PM CEST, with the game being priced at $19.99 / £16.75 / €19.50.
The launch price point positions Jump Space competitively within the indie multiplayer market. However, Jump Space will not be in the Steam Autumn Sale. As development progresses, the price may increase (for example when leaving Early Access).
This transparent pricing strategy rewards early adopters while ensuring sustainable development funding. Players who purchase during early access lock in the lowest price while supporting the game's continued evolution.

Keepsake Games, the Swedish studio founded by veterans of Hazelight, Mojang, and Coffee Stain, brings impressive pedigree to Jump Space's development. This experienced team understands what makes cooperative games compelling, drawing from their work on titles like It Takes Two, Minecraft, and Deep Rock Galactic.
Keepsake co-founder Filip Coulianos was previously a level designer at Hazelight (It Takes Two, A Way Out), and it's a discipline that remains dear to his heart. This expertise shows in Jump Space's handcrafted missions that balance randomized elements with carefully designed encounters.
The studio's commitment to community engagement has been evident throughout development. During Steam Next Fest alone, they released multiple patches addressing player feedback, demonstrating the responsive development approach that will continue through early access.
The game's journey included an unexpected challenge when "Jump Space is the final name following trademark complications." Rather than derailing development, Keepsake Games used this setback as an opportunity to refine their vision and build even stronger community anticipation.
